Attention and Affection

Poodles will often follow their owners around the house and pay close attention to what they’re doing. They’ll often jump up and give their owners a hug or a kiss, which is their way of showing that they’re loved and appreciated.

Poodles also love to be petted and scratched. They’ll often come up to their owners and nudge them with their noses or paw at their legs to get their attention. When their owners give them attention, they’ll often show their appreciation by wagging their tails and licking their owners’ hands and faces.

Playing with Toys

Poodles love to play with toys, and this is another way that they show their love for their owners. When their owners are around, they’ll often bring their favorite toys to them and ask to play. They’ll also often carry their toys around and show them off to their owners.

Staying Close

Poodles are known for their loyalty, and they’ll often stay close to their owners. They’ll often follow their owners around the house and lay beside them when they’re sitting down or sleeping. This is their way of showing that they’re always there for them.

Protecting Their Owners

Poodles are also very protective of their owners, and they’ll often bark or growl when they sense something is wrong or when someone unfamiliar is nearby. This is their way of letting their owners know that they’re there to protect them.

How can I prevent my Poodle from becoming bored?

To prevent your Poodle from becoming bored, it is important to provide them with plenty of mental and physical stimulation. Take them for daily walks, teach them new tricks, play with them or take them to the park. You can also give them interactive toys and puzzles to keep their minds engaged.
